Everything You Need Before You Apply
Must be valid for at least 6 months beyond your intended stay in South Africa. Include all current and previous passports. If lost, provide an FIR copy.
Recent passport-size photos (35×45 mm) with a white background and matt finish. Full-face, neutral expression.
Copy of your CNIC (Computerized National Identity Card).
Family Registration Certificate (FRC).
Marriage Registration Certificate (for applicants applying with family).
A formal request letter on your official letterhead (if applicable).
Bank statement for the last 3 months, signed and stamped by the bank.
Account maintenance letter from the bank, signed and stamped.
Polio vaccination certificate and Yellow Fever card are mandatory for travelers from certain regions.
Travel insurance, hotel booking, travel plan, flight reservation.
Visa application form (drafted by us).
Visa appointment scheduling and arrangements.
Employment letter from HR mentioning your designation, salary, and duration of service.
Last 3 months’ salary slips.
NTN (if applicable).
Company NTN (if applicable).
Chamber of Commerce membership certificate (if applicable).
Tax returns (if applicable).
Bonafide letter from your school/college/university.
Copy of your student card.
Proof of property ownership.
Property evaluation report on stamp paper.
PMDC certificate (for doctors).
Ex-Pakistan leave approval (for government employees).

A South Africa visit visa is usually issued for up to 90 days, depending on your travel plan and supporting documents.
Yes, if you are traveling from or through a yellow fever endemic country, a valid yellow fever vaccination certificate is mandatory.
There’s no fixed rule, but having a sufficient balance to cover flights, stay, and daily expenses (typically at least PKR 500,000 or more) strengthens your case.
No, South Africa does not offer a full e-visa system for Pakistani citizens. You’ll need to apply through the visa facilitation center, but we handle the entire process for you.
Processing usually takes around 15–20 working days, but it may vary depending on the season and individual application details.
Not mandatory for tourists, but if you’re visiting family or friends, an invitation letter can strongly support your application.
